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/wpf/12.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
在WPF中创建一个实例的控件模板_Wpf_Xaml_Controltemplate - Fatal编程技术网

在WPF中创建一个实例的控件模板

在WPF中创建一个实例的控件模板,wpf,xaml,controltemplate,Wpf,Xaml,Controltemplate,我已经研究过使用控件模板在两个视图之间使用相同的XAML代码。但是,我在哪里存储此控件模板,以便两个视图都可以访问它,从而显示我需要的控件 谢谢如果两个视图位于同一窗口下,您可以将控制模板存储在窗口下。资源如果两个视图都属于不同的窗口将其存储在应用程序下。资源谢谢,我是否只在主窗口或任何视图下创建应用程序。资源?否应用程序。资源在App.xaml中声明。谢谢,如果允许,我将接受。这是复制控件(即在视图之间过滤的数据网格)的最佳方式吗,这就是我的问题。为什么不创建UserControl并在两个视图

我已经研究过使用控件模板在两个视图之间使用相同的XAML代码。但是,我在哪里存储此控件模板,以便两个视图都可以访问它,从而显示我需要的控件


谢谢

如果两个视图位于同一窗口下,您可以将
控制模板
存储在
窗口下。资源
如果两个视图都属于不同的窗口将其存储在
应用程序下。资源
谢谢,我是否只在主窗口或任何视图下创建应用程序。资源?否
应用程序。资源
App.xaml
中声明。谢谢,如果允许,我将接受。这是复制控件(即在视图之间过滤的数据网格)的最佳方式吗,这就是我的问题。为什么不创建
UserControl
并在两个视图中使用它呢?这正是我最初想要的,但有人告诉我不要!